Protests in the Middle East reflect public anger at Israel’s bombardment of Gaza.
Published on Friday 20 October 2023.
Israel’s relentless bombardment of the besieged Gaza Strip has killed and injured thousands, with entire communities left homeless.
Many people in Arab nations are watching in horror, and thousands have taken part in protests across the Middle East to reject Israel’s assault on Gaza. What political impact will Israel’s onslaught have on leaders in the region?
Could there be lasting implications?
